Markdown to HTML कनवर्टर
Markdown to HTML कनवर्टर आपके Markdown टेक्स्ट को ब्राउज़र में ही तेजी से semantic HTML5 में बदलता है। यह टूल पूरी तरह क्लाइंट-साइड चलता है, जिससे कोई भी डेटा सर्वर पर अपलोड नहीं होता।
Markdown to HTML कनवर्टर Markdown को semantic HTML5 में परिवर्तित करता है, जो marked लाइब्रेरी पर आधारित है और CommonMark व GFM एक्सटेंशन्स को सपोर्ट करता है। यह टूल ब्राउज़र में चलता है, जिससे आपका Markdown कंटेंट कहीं भी अपलोड किए बिना सुरक्षित रहता है। headings से लेकर tables और code blocks तक, सभी Markdown सिंटैक्स को HTML टैग्स जैसे <h1>-<h6>, <strong>, <pre><code> में बदला जाता है। यदि आप HTML को Markdown में बदलना चाहते हैं तो Html To Markdown टूल उपयोग करें, या HTML फाइल को मिनिफाई करने के लिए Html Minifier देखें।
कैसे उपयोग करें
- टेक्स्ट एरिया में अपना Markdown कंटेंट लिखें या पेस्ट करें।
- ऑटोमैटिक रूप से आपका Markdown semantic HTML5 में कन्वर्ट हो जाएगा।
- परिणाम को कॉपी करें या अपने प्रोजेक्ट में उपयोग करें।
- यदि आवश्यक हो तो CSS के साथ आउटपुट HTML को स्टाइल करें।
यह कैसे काम करता है
यह टूल marked लाइब्रेरी का उपयोग करता है, जो CommonMark स्पेसिफिकेशन और GitHub Flavored Markdown (GFM) एक्सटेंशन्स को सपोर्ट करता है। Markdown के हेडिंग्स (#-######), बोल्ड/इटैलिक (**bold**, *italic*), लिंक, इमेजेस, fenced कोड ब्लॉक्स (```), टेबल्स, टास्क लिस्ट और ब्लॉककोट्स को HTML5 के semantic टैग्स (<h1>-<h6>, <strong>, <em>, <pre><code>, <table>) में बदला जाता है। यह प्रोसेस पूरी तरह ब्राउज़र में होता है जिससे आपकी प्राइवेसी सुरक्षित रहती है और कोई डेटा सर्वर पर भेजा नहीं जाता।
उदाहरण
# शीर्षक 1
यह **बोल्ड** टेक्स्ट है और यह *इटैलिक* है।
- [x] टास्क 1
- [ ] टास्क 2
```javascript
console.log('Hello, world!');
```
| कॉलम 1 | कॉलम 2 |
|--------|--------|
| डेटा 1 | डेटा 2 |
परिणामस्वरूप HTML आउटपुट:
<h1>शीर्षक 1</h1>
<p>यह <strong>बोल्ड</strong> टेक्स्ट है और यह <em>इटैलिक</em> है।</p>
<ul>
<li><input type='checkbox' checked disabled> टास्क 1</li>
<li><input type='checkbox' disabled> टास्क 2</li>
</ul>
<pre><code class="language-javascript">console.log('Hello, world!');
</code></pre>
<table>
<thead>
<tr><th>कॉलम 1</th><th>कॉलम 2</th></tr>
</thead>
<tbody>
<tr><td>डेटा 1</td><td>डेटा 2</td></tr>
</tbody>
</table>
कब उपयोग करें
- डेवलपर्स जो Markdown में डॉक्यूमेंटेशन लिखकर HTML में कन्वर्ट करना चाहते हैं।
- डिजाइनर्स जो Markdown कंटेंट को वेबसाइट पर semantic HTML में दिखाना चाहते हैं।
- SEO विशेषज्ञ जो कंटेंट को structured HTML5 टैग्स में बदलना चाहते हैं ताकि सर्च इंजन बेहतर इंडेक्सिंग कर सकें।
- छात्र और लेखक जो टेक्स्ट को Markdown से HTML में जल्दी और प्राइवेसी के साथ कन्वर्ट करना चाहते हैं।
यदि आप HTML को Markdown में वापस बदलना चाहते हैं, तो Html To Markdown टूल उपयोग करें। HTML को मिनिफाई करने के लिए Html Minifier सहायक है। HTML के एन्कोडिंग और डिकोडिंग के लिए Html Encoder Decoder देखें।
अक्सर पूछे जाने वाले सवाल
Markdown to HTML कनवर्टर किस लाइब्रेरी का उपयोग करता है?
यह टूल marked लाइब्रेरी का उपयोग करता है, जो CommonMark स्पेसिफिकेशन के साथ GitHub Flavored Markdown (GFM) एक्सटेंशन्स को सपोर्ट करता है।
क्या इस टूल में डेटा ब्राउज़र के बाहर जाता है?
नहीं, यह पूरी प्रक्रिया ब्राउज़र में क्लाइंट-साइड होती है, इसलिए आपका डेटा कहीं भी अपलोड नहीं होता और प्राइवेसी बनी रहती है।
क्या यह टूल टेबल्स और कोड ब्लॉक्स को सपोर्ट करता है?
हाँ, Markdown टेबल्स (GFM टेबल्स) और fenced कोड ब्लॉक्स (``` से घिरे हुए) दोनों HTML5 टैग्स में कन्वर्ट होते हैं।
मैं HTML को Markdown में कैसे बदल सकता हूँ?
HTML को Markdown में बदलने के लिए आप Html To Markdown टूल का उपयोग कर सकते हैं, जो HTML टैग्स को Markdown सिंटैक्स में परिवर्तित करता है।
क्या आउटपुट HTML5 semantic टैग्स का उपयोग करता है?
हाँ, आउटपुट में <h1>-<h6>, <strong>, <em>, <pre><code>, <table> जैसे semantic टैग्स का उपयोग होता है।